About B. Premjith
B. Premjith is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Signal Processing,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and Computer Networks and Communications, having authored 39 papers that have together received 387 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Natural Language Processing Techniques (18 papers), Topic Modeling (13 papers), Hate Speech and Cyberbullying Detection (7 papers), Speech Recognition and Synthesis (6 papers), Speech and Audio Processing (5 papers), Sentiment Analysis and Opinion Mining (4 papers), Handwritten Text Recognition Techniques (4 papers) and Phonetics and Phonology Research (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Artificial Intelligence (293 citations), Signal Processing (32 citations), Communication (20 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(58 citations) and Information Systems (50 citations). B. Premjith has collaborated with scholars based in India, Australia and Saudi Arabia. Frequent co-authors include K. P. Soman, K Sreelakshmi, M. Anand Kumar, Soman K.P., K. B. Anand, Dhanya Sathyan, Bharathi Raja Chakravarthi, John P. McCrae, Thomas Mandl and Prabaharan Poornachandran. Their work appears in journals such as Scientific Reports, Array, Engineering Applications of Artificial Intelligence, Indian Journal of Science and Technology and IEEE Access.
